Rho Leonis is a massive blue supergiant in Leo and one of the most luminous stars known.

Stellar Data

Apparent Magnitude3.85
Absolute Magnitude-6.97
Distance5,000 light-years
Spectral TypeB1Iab
Temperature22,000 K
Luminosity295,000 L☉
Radius37 R☉
Mass20 M☉
Right Ascension10h 32m 48.7s
Declination+09° 18′ 23.7″
ConstellationLeo

Notable Facts

  • Rho Leonis is about 295,000 times more luminous than the Sun
  • It is one of the most distant bright stars in Leo
  • The star is a B-type supergiant
